Ann Simpson

BirthAbt 1757 - Barton, N Yorkshire, England
Death1800 - Not Available
MotherElizabeth Lazenby
FatherBartholomew. Simpson

Born in Barton, N Yorkshire, England on Abt 1757 to Bartholomew. Simpson and Elizabeth Lazenby. Ann Simpson married Ralph Goldsbrough and had 10 children. She passed away on 1800.
